WebKathleen Raine, a poet deeply influenced by Yeats, offered a useful formula: “For Yeats magic was not so much a kind of poetry as poetry a kind of magic, and the object of both alike was evocation of energies and knowledge from beyond normal consciousness.”. The salient word there is “evocation,” casting the poet as a magus conjuring ... WebPDF On Feb 28, 2010, Sahar Abdul-Ameer Al-Husseini published Mythology in W. B. The Body feeling itself to be a victim of the Soul’s … WebThe Bird and the Beast Symbol. The bird ‘symbol’ is one of the most important symbols in Yeats’s poems. It is a striking example of the dynamic nature of the Yeatsian symbol which grows, changes and acquires greater depth and density in their progression. A similar process may be traced in the ‘beast imagery.’.
